Detailed Course Descriptions
The department places significant emphasis on advanced elective courses that allow students to explore specialized areas within the field of education. These courses are designed to deepen understanding and foster critical thinking while preparing students for real-world challenges.
Educational Technology Applications
This course explores how digital tools can be effectively integrated into educational settings to enhance learning outcomes. Students learn about virtual reality, augmented reality, artificial intelligence, and gamification in education. The course includes hands-on sessions where students develop interactive learning modules using various platforms.
Special Education
This course focuses on inclusive education practices for children with diverse learning needs. Topics include identification of special needs, individualized education plans (IEPs), assistive technologies, and strategies for supporting learners with disabilities in mainstream classrooms.
Educational Psychology
Students examine cognitive processes, motivation theories, and behavioral interventions that impact educational environments. The course includes case studies and practical sessions on psychological assessment techniques and counseling approaches.
Higher Education Systems
This course provides an overview of higher education institutions globally, focusing on governance, administration, and policy frameworks. Students analyze the role of universities in society and explore trends in global education systems.
Curriculum Planning and Evaluation
This course equips students with skills to design, implement, and evaluate educational curricula across different levels. It covers curriculum theories, assessment strategies, and methods for continuous improvement based on feedback from stakeholders.
Educational Leadership
The focus of this course is on developing leadership competencies among educators. Students learn about change management, team building, conflict resolution, and ethical decision-making in educational contexts.
Advanced Teaching Methods
This course delves into contemporary teaching strategies that promote active learning and student engagement. It covers methods such as flipped classrooms, project-based learning, and collaborative inquiry approaches.
Educational Data Analytics
Students learn to collect, analyze, and interpret educational data to inform decision-making processes. The course includes training on statistical software tools used in education research and evaluation.
Community-Based Education
This course explores how schools can collaborate with communities to address local challenges and promote inclusive development. Students engage in fieldwork projects that connect classroom learning with real-world applications.
Educational Policy and Reform
This course analyzes the evolution of educational policies and their impact on teaching and learning practices. Students examine national and international policy frameworks and evaluate reform initiatives using evidence-based approaches.
Project-Based Learning Approach
M K University Patan adopts a project-based learning approach to foster critical thinking, collaboration, and innovation among students. This pedagogical strategy encourages students to apply theoretical knowledge in practical scenarios while working on real-world problems.
Mini-Projects
Throughout the program, students undertake mini-projects that allow them to explore specific topics within education. These projects are typically completed in small groups and involve research, data collection, and presentation components. Mini-projects help students develop analytical skills and gain experience working collaboratively.
Final-Year Thesis/Capstone Project
The final-year capstone project is a significant component of the program that requires students to conduct independent research or develop an innovative educational initiative. Students select a topic relevant to their specialization, work closely with a faculty mentor, and present their findings in both written and oral formats.
Project Selection Process
Students begin selecting projects during their third year based on their interests and career goals. Faculty mentors guide students through the process of refining project ideas, setting objectives, and developing timelines. The selection process ensures that each student's project aligns with their specialization and contributes meaningfully to the field of education.
